send and receive simultaneously

values were ok, EDDB has a mag derivation of ~4° *facepalm*
This commit is contained in:
2024-01-21 19:40:19 +01:00
parent 6c04cdf97f
commit ace99dfe93
3 changed files with 17 additions and 30 deletions

View File

@@ -14,17 +14,17 @@ int main(int argc, char *argv[]) {
}
// network
xPlaneSocket = connectXPlane(DEST_SERVER, DEST_PORT, SRC_PORT);
xPlaneSocket = createSocket(SRC_PORT);
if (xPlaneSocket < 0) {
exit(EXIT_FAILURE);
}
// send payload
if (sendToXPlane(xPlaneSocket, "CMND", argv[1], strlen(argv[1])) < 0) {
if (sendToXPlane(xPlaneSocket, DEST_SERVER, DEST_PORT, "CMND", argv[1], strlen(argv[1])) < 0) {
exit(EXIT_FAILURE);
}
// bye bye (and no, I don't care about error anymore; I'll exit anyway?!)
disconnectXPlane(xPlaneSocket);
closeSocket(xPlaneSocket);
exit(EXIT_SUCCESS);
}